Multiple Major Fires in Scotland and Essex Engaged Over 50 Fire Crews

News summary

Multiple significant fires have been reported in Scotland and Essex, with emergency services responding rapidly to contain the blazes and ensure public safety. In Kilmarnock, six fire engines and two specialist units are battling a large fire at the rear of a commercial building on King Street, with residents advised to avoid the area; no injuries have been reported so far. In Dundee, over 40 firefighters and seven fire engines were deployed to tackle a major fire at a block of flats on Roslin Gardens, with no initial injuries reported as the blaze was brought under control. Meanwhile, in Essex, fire crews responded to a large fire at a former poultry shed on Bardfield Road, successfully preventing the fire from spreading to nearby buildings and fields, though the cause remains under investigation. Fire services in all locations have praised the efforts of firefighters working under challenging conditions, and continue to monitor the scenes for flare-ups. Authorities continue to urge the public to stay clear of affected areas to facilitate emergency operations.
